Wed Oct 16 07:02:53 -0000 2024 UTC– Antofagasta plc CEO reported a 15% increase in copper production in Q3 2024 due to destocking at Los Pelambres and better performance at Centinela, aiming to reach 670-710,000 tonnes by the year-end.

Construction on growth projects continued, anticipating 660-700,000 tonnes in 2025 with increased output at Centinela.
